Lost in My Mind by The Head and the Heart
Key: D · 96 BPM · 3/4
Lost in My Mind by The Head and the Heart is written in D major. Rather than one of the handful of progressions that show up again and again across pop and rock, it settles into its own 2-chord loop — D-G — repeating with its own internal logic instead of borrowing a familiar shape. At 96 BPM, it moves at a relaxed, mid-tempo pace, in waltz time.
